102 in Roman Numerals - CII

The Roman numeral for 102 is CII. This number continues the natural progression in the second century, combining C (100) with II (2) through simple additive notation.

How to Write 102 in Roman Numerals

To write 102 in Roman numerals, we combine C (100) with II (2) using additive notation.

The Roman numeral system represents 102 as CII, following the additive principle where symbols are placed in descending order of value.

Mathematical Significance

102 is an abundant composite number with prime factorization 2 × 3 × 17. As an abundant number, the sum of its proper divisors (114) exceeds the number itself, making it significant in number theory studies.

Mathematical Properties of 102

The number 102 possesses several interesting mathematical properties that classify it in various number theory categories.

  • Composite number with prime factorization 2 × 3 × 17
  • Abundant number (sum of proper divisors = 114 > 102)
  • Even number divisible by 2, 3, 6, 17, 34, 51
  • Has 8 total divisors: 1, 2, 3, 6, 17, 34, 51, 102
  • Semiperfect number (can be expressed as sum of distinct divisors)
